In the last few weeks
SoA have been working as a talent factory for the other Danish top team,
NoA.
After ESWC,
ArcadioN decided to leave the team and join
team fightclub. Only one day after
mJe and
FaagaN decided to leave the team, joining up with NoA. With three missing players
Bloddy and
zone needed to build the team up once again, but it was without Bloddy, since he decided to walk into inactivity.
Some week’s later zone and the SoA crew could announce 4 new players.
Sunde and
ave came from Evermore,
pzyclone from
team fatcap and the last guy,
elevate were clanless. It started out very well and on the same day as
the team were founded they had a CB EC match against, Team NoA. A match
they lost with 2 to 1, but they showed that they weren’t untalented.
All people thought everything were okay until NoA announced that FaagaN
walked into inactivity and ave from SoA joined the team. This means
that SoA will particpate BattleIT with a standin, and who else than
FaagaN could act as standin?

SoA is given a forth seed; since they haven’t been playing as much as necessary, but as individual players they are superior to most of the participating teams. If everything falls into place, SoA might even finish higher.
